India’s Oscar entry ‘Chhello Show’ child actor Rahul Koli dies of cancer

Lagatar News by Lagatar News
October 11, 2022
in Entertainment
Share on FacebookShare on Twitter

Lagatar24 Desk

 

New Delhi, Oct 11: Rahul Koli, child actor of Chhello Show or Last Film Show fame, passed away from cancer at the age of 15. He was one of the six young actors in the movie that serves as India’s official submission for the 95th Academy Awards’ Best International Feature Film category.

Rahul’s father reportedly stated that the deceased child star had experienced numerous fever attacks prior to passing away and had also vomited blood. He stated that the family would watch Chhello Show collectively following Rahul’s final rites. The movie will release on October 14.

“On Sunday, October 2, he had his breakfast and then after repeated bouts of fever in the following hours, Rahul vomited blood thrice and just like that my child was no more. Our family is devastated. But we will watch his ‘last film show’ together on the release day on October 14 after we perform his final purification rituals,” said father Ramu Koli.

The time period of Last Film Show, which is at the dawn of the digital revolution, was inspired by Pan Nalin’s personal memories of falling in love with movies as a young child in rural Gujarat. The narrative of a nine-year-old boy, who begins a lifelong love affair with cinema after he bribes his way into a dilapidated movie theatre and spends a summer viewing films from the projection booth, is told in this movie, which is set in a distant rural community in Saurashtra.

The film, starring debutant child actor Bhavin Rabari as Samay, had premiered at the 2021 edition of the New York-set Tribeca Film Festival.
